The City of Janesville steps up it’s response to the world wide health crisis.
City Manager Mark Freitag provided a live update from the Emergency Response Center Friday morning where he told citizens the City’s response is moving to a level two.
Freitag says some City services will start to be affected including the closure of all City customer service windows accept the one on the first floor of City Hall near the Wall Street entrance.
So far the City of Janesville’s Emergency Operations Center response team has spent 1,077 man hours and more than $58,000 on the response to the COVID-19 pandemic.
